¿Cuánto cuesta alquilar un apartamento en Whitestone?
| Dormitorios | Precio Promedio | Más barato | Más caro |
|---|---|---|---|
| Apartamentos Estudio en Whitestone | $3,542 | $1,700 | $6,999 |
| Apartamentos 1 Dormitorios en Whitestone | $2,551 | $800 | $3,500 |
| Apartamentos 2 Dormitorios en Whitestone | $3,335 | $2,100 | $6,000 |
| Apartamentos 3 Dormitorios en Whitestone | $3,331 | $2,650 | $4,350 |
| Apartamentos 4 Dormitorios en Whitestone | $4,033 | $3,600 | $4,600 |
